Officers from Metropolitan Police Roads and Transport Policing Command have issued images of a man who is suspected to have seriously assaulted a bus driver in Croydon.

The assault happened on April 16 at01.40am on College Road, Croydon, whilst the driver was parked in front of Croydon College.

The driver was checking the top deck of the number 75 bus whilst not in service when he heard the doors opening. When he came down to check who had opened the door he saw the man inside the bus.

The man attacked the driver and subjected him to become a victim of a violent assault.

The driver was taken to Croydon University Hospital for treatment. He had a large cut on his forehead, with bruising to his face and chin.

Anyone who witnessed the accident or has any information are asked to contact Detective Constable Anthony Barun, of the Roads and Transport Policing Command, on 07801 203174.
